What Locals Need to Be Aware Of
As these tech trends become more prevalent, there are a few key things we should all be mindful of:
- Cybersecurity: With more online activity, protecting our personal information is paramount. Be cautious of phishing scams and ensure your devices are secure.
- Digital Divide: We need to ensure that everyone, regardless of age or technical skill, can benefit from these advancements. Local initiatives offering digital literacy training are incredibly important.
- Privacy: Understand how your data is being used, especially with smart devices and online services.
- Embracing Lifelong Learning: Technology evolves rapidly. Staying curious and open to learning new digital tools will keep us all connected and empowered.
